MANCHESTER, CT — Three people were seriously hurt in a two-car crash in Manchester on Tuesday.

The crash took place in the early afternoon at the intersection of West Center and Cooper Streets.

When firefighters arrived at the scene, they encountered two people under one of the vehicles after being ejected, officials said.

Firefighters were able to pull them to safety without lifting the vehicle, officials said. Both vehicles were left in mangled messes.

Four people, three of which suffered "potentially life-threatening injuries," were transported to local trauma centers, officials said.
